Aswathy Udayan is a scholar working on Renewable Energy, Sustainability and the Environment, Health, Toxicology and Mutagenesis and Plant Science. According to data from OpenAlex, Aswathy Udayan has authored 15 papers receiving a total of 810 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 9 papers in Renewable Energy, Sustainability and the Environment, 4 papers in Health, Toxicology and Mutagenesis and 4 papers in Plant Science. Recurrent topics in Aswathy Udayan's work include Algal biology and biofuel production (9 papers), Chromium effects and bioremediation (4 papers) and Biocrusts and Microbial Ecology (2 papers). Aswathy Udayan is often cited by papers focused on Algal biology and biofuel production (9 papers), Chromium effects and bioremediation (4 papers) and Biocrusts and Microbial Ecology (2 papers). Aswathy Udayan collaborates with scholars based in India, South Korea and Switzerland. Aswathy Udayan's co-authors include Ashutosh Kumar Pandey, Pooja Sharma, Sunil Kumar, Nidhin Sreekumar, Ranjna Sirohi, Muthu Arumugam, Byoung‐In Sang, Ashok Pandey, Sang–Hyoun Kim and Sang Jun Sim and has published in prestigious journals such as Bioresource Technology, Environmental Pollution and Chemosphere.
